St. Louis Metropolitan Police Department, Missouri
End of Watch Tuesday, June 12, 1990
Add to My HeroesLorenzo L. Rodgers
Police Officer Lorenzo Rodgers was shot and killed when he attempted to take action during an armed robbery while off duty.
He was standing in front of a laundromat, at Des Peres Avenue and Washington Boulevard, when a man approached and produced a handgun. Officer Rodgers drew his service revolver and exchanged shots with the man. Both men were struck and Officer Rodgers succumbed to his wounds.
The suspect was apprehended a short time later and charged with murder. He was convicted of murder and paroled in June 2010.
Officer Rodgers was assigned to the 8th District and had been with the agency for only 14 months. He was survived by his grandmother.
